Washington State's only AVA west of the Cascades (~121 planted acres), temperate oceanic climate with warm dry summers, glacial sandy-gravelly soils. Pinot Noir signature as cool-climate red: elegant and silky with red cherry, raspberry, undergrowth and fine spices, fine tannins and freshness. Star Madeleine Angevine native white (early Loire cross, citrus, flowers), taut Riesling, aromatic Müller-Thurgau and Siegerrebe. Fresh maritime niche whites.
